Replying to my own post from a while back, I've been piloting 11g hostap
with 128-bit WEP for several days now and I haven't experienced any
noticeable issues.  I'm using a Hawking Hi-Gain Wireless-G Laptop
Card--model HWC54D which is not listed in the man page--for this and it
also happens to come with a small rotatable 6dBi antenna.

Relevant dmesg:

$ dmesg | grep ral0
ral0 at cardbus1 dev 0 function 0 "Ralink Technology, Inc., RT2500,
802.11  CardBus Reference Card": irq 11, address 00:0e:3b:07:a2:13
ral0: MAC/BBP RT2560 (rev 0x04), RF RT2525
